Rough idle could be related to a vacuum leak. You probably should replace the hoses that are red in this picture:
http://www.saabnet.com/tsn/bb/9000/index.html?bID=279160
The hose running behind the oil filler tube goes to the hooter valve on the intake pipe.
While you're at it, make sure the PCV is oriented correctly (arrow pointing towards intake manifold) and that you can't blow/suck air through the PCV in both directions; air should only flow in the direction of the intake mainfold. The nipple on the valve cover fits into a rubber grommet that is probably showing its age at 103K miles. The grommet is a cheap part. Another vacuum hose that's sneaky is the one to the charcoal canister. You have to remove the right turn signal (not difficult to do) in order to see/feel inside the right side fender well where the vacuum hose connects at the top of the canister. You can test the diaphragm inside the hooter valve by sucking/blowing on it; if you can move air, then replace the valve. Don't replace the little hose going to the MAP sensor (mounted to the false firewall on the passenger side) unless it is damaged. If you do replace it, use the genuine Saab part.
If the rough idle persists after all that, then you may need to clean the IAC (idle air control). That has been written about somewhere on this board.
